Dry Well Replacement in Tuscaloosa, AL

Dry well replacement services involve removing and installing a new dry well system to help manage excess groundwater and surface runoff on residential properties. These systems are typically used in projects where drainage issues cause water to pool or where existing dry wells have become clogged, damaged, or ineffective over time. Property owners often seek this service when experiencing persistent soggy yards, basement flooding, or drainage problems that cannot be resolved with simple grading or landscaping adjustments. Understanding the condition of the current dry well, the property’s drainage needs, and the appropriate size and type of replacement system are important considerations before requesting this service.

This service covers a range of projects, including replacing aging or broken dry wells, upgrading to larger systems for increased water flow, or installing new dry wells in areas where drainage was previously inadequate. Property owners should be aware that proper installation is essential for effective drainage management and that the choice of materials and system size depends on factors like soil type, property layout, and expected water volume. Consulting with a drainage specialist can help determine the most suitable solution to ensure proper water flow and prevent future drainage issues.

FAQ

Dry Well Replacement Questions

What is a dry well replacement? It involves removing an old or damaged dry well and installing a new one to help manage excess water runoff on a property.

When should a dry well be replaced? Replacement is recommended if the dry well is clogged, overflowing, or no longer effectively draining water.

What types of properties typically need dry well replacement? Properties with extensive landscaping, drainage issues, or large impervious surfaces often require dry well replacement to prevent water pooling.

What signs indicate a dry well may need replacement? Signs include persistent surface water, soggy ground, or foul odors near the dry well area.
